Description

If you love France and are curious about all things French, this book is for you. In it you will find stories exploring the curious histories behind everyday French symbols: From berets to baguettes, and beyond.

You will discover:

- How the baguette got its distinctive shape

- Why the French are represented by a rooster

- Who created the beret-wearing French stereotype

- Why the guillotine was invented

- Why there are gargoyles on Gothic churches

- And much more…
